D.J. Dozier is a running back who played college football at Penn State. He was selected by the Minnesota Vikings in the 1st round (14th overall pick) of the 1987 NFL Draft. He carried the ball for 691 rushing yards and 7 touchdowns across 43 career games. As a first-round selection, D.J. Dozier was considered one of the top prospects in the 1987 NFL Draft class.
